
Muthurwa traders have given the county government of Nairobi a seven days ultimatum to ensure all the garbage hipped in the market is collected.
Muthurwa traders leader Nelson waithaka says the county government of Nairobi has failed to ensure standard hygiene procedures are upheld in the market a factor he says puts the lives of those traders at risk of contracting diseases.
The traders also expressed displeasure on how the county government is running market affairs without involving them.
